Now, onto the star of the show: window tint. If you're in a sunny spot like California, Arizona, or Texas, this is one of the first upgrades you should make. Teslas have massive glass surfaces (hello, panoramic roof), so they heat up fast. Good tint blocks UV rays and infrared heat, keeping your cabin cooler and protecting your skin and interior.
But not all tints are created equal. I learned this the hard way with my first Tesla. I went to the cheapest shop, and the results were disastrous—hazy clarity, poor cuts, and it made driving unbearable (especially since we tinted the windshield). Don't make my mistake; invest in quality.
Tesla's app might prompt you for tint during pre-delivery, but skip it. They just blast your info to random XPEL dealers, and you lose control. Instead, head to the XPEL website for transparent pricing upfront.
